Is Thrive PremiumPlus Salmon & Herring Grain-free Cat Food dry cat food good?
Thrive PremiumPlus Salmon & Herring Grain-free Cat Food is a dry cat food rated 5 stars, with high ingredient transparency and strong animal protein content. The recipe lists most animal ingredients by name and features real muscle meat as a primary protein source. This recipe is free from Gluten grains, Grains (gluten-free), Dairy, Egg, Nuts, Poultry, Red meat, Shellfish, Unknown Meal but contains Legumes, Fish.

Protein Analysis
How this recipe earned its protein scores.
Protein Clarity
High
High
Named
100%
Strong clarity: 100% of Thrive PremiumPlus Salmon & Herring Grain-free Cat Food's animal-protein ingredients are clearly named (like chicken or salmon). Only 0% use vague terms such as "meat meal" and 0% are by-products. Named protein ingredients let you verify the source and check for allergens.
